Particular focus and specializations:
- Sleep and Epilepsy
- EEG
- Neuroimmunology
Clinically, Dr. H. is a visiting responsible for supervision of EEG and Konsilien in the ICU, general neurological Konsilien in the island's hospital as a part of outpatients with insomnia (sleep-wake center).
The focus of research is on the neurophysiology of sleep and epilepsy and their disorders by immunological processes. Methodology in this regard is the analysis of brain electrical activity in humans by means of extra-and intracranial macro-and micro-electrodes (in cooperation with the research group of Prof. F. Mormann, Bonn) in the foreground.
